Maybe not running Aero with Glass, but I bet a server-class system (16 GB of RAM, 4 dual-proc processors) could do it alright. A lot of those systems run up to 10-15 instances of Windows Server 2003. And by Moore's law and economics... how long will it be before a normal desktop that Dell sells for $400 can as well?
I've scanned through the number of replies regarding this and I just find a number of fanboys saying this is the triumph of Open Source over the gigantic evil corporation. The fact is, this is a smart move to promote Microsoft technology (VPC) that has had a bad reputation, but has seen steady improvement.
VPC isn't so much competition for Xen as much as it for VmWare Workstation. Both VPC and VmWare allow the installation of unmodified operating systems (not so much VPC), whereas Xen requires them to be ported or "enlighted". Tack on the fact that Xen only runs on Linux, and the ported version of XP is unavailable due to copyright issues, and Xen doesn't look like a very realistic solution for the primary uses of virtualization technology, developers testing their software on a different OS, or sysadmins running virtual servers (production, or testing of Windows platforms). Yes, some people do prefer Windows Server 2003 over BSD.
VPC on the other had, works well enough for testing on a variety of Windows platforms, will now be free, and is in most cases good enough. The primary reason I can think of why someone would virtualize instances of Vista is to provide RDP access to a sandboxed environment, not to use Vista as a server. VPC and this Vista deal shouldn't be seen as a competitor to Xen. If you're planning on virtualizing instances of a server, especially a Windows Server, VmWare GSX or ESX server would be the only real options.
Regarding licensing issues, a virtual machine is exactly that, a virtual representation of a completely different machine. It will show up the the OS as different hardware. Have any of you tried activating an XP installation within VPC or VmWare? It still asks for a new, unique key (unless of course, its a volume license). People question the financial costs of this, that Microsoft will now forgo the revenue on four vista licenses. First of all, many estimate that Vista will retail at as low as $100. There will actually be tighter license restrictions, as there are plans to have an active licensing server for volume licenses, instead of the honor system currently in place (which is often abused).
The motivation of this deal isn't to make money, its to promote certain technologies, and to encourage people to convert and stay with the Windows platform. Why does Microsoft give away millions of dollars of software in the form of the MSDN Academic Alliance every year to schools and students? Why does it have an entire "software evangelist" program? It's not to make money in the immediate short term, but to make people convert to Microsoft products, many of which are quite well made. (Anyone play with Visual Studio Team Foundation Server?) Sure, there are open source alternatives but sometimes its easier to click a few buttons on a GUI instead of customizing a.conf file. And, if people convert to the Microsoft way of doing things, they're more likely to purchase the money makers, like Office, or use certain software solutions when making purchasing decisions for their IT department.
Maybe not running Aero with Glass, but I bet a server-class system (16 GB of RAM, 4 dual-proc processors) could do it alright. A lot of those systems run up to 10-15 instances of Windows Server 2003. And by Moore's law and economics... how long will it be before a normal desktop that Dell sells for $400 can as well?
I've scanned through the number of replies regarding this and I just find a number of fanboys saying this is the triumph of Open Source over the gigantic evil corporation. The fact is, this is a smart move to promote Microsoft technology (VPC) that has had a bad reputation, but has seen steady improvement. VPC isn't so much competition for Xen as much as it for VmWare Workstation. Both VPC and VmWare allow the installation of unmodified operating systems (not so much VPC), whereas Xen requires them to be ported or "enlighted". Tack on the fact that Xen only runs on Linux, and the ported version of XP is unavailable due to copyright issues, and Xen doesn't look like a very realistic solution for the primary uses of virtualization technology, developers testing their software on a different OS, or sysadmins running virtual servers (production, or testing of Windows platforms). Yes, some people do prefer Windows Server 2003 over BSD. VPC on the other had, works well enough for testing on a variety of Windows platforms, will now be free, and is in most cases good enough. The primary reason I can think of why someone would virtualize instances of Vista is to provide RDP access to a sandboxed environment, not to use Vista as a server. VPC and this Vista deal shouldn't be seen as a competitor to Xen. If you're planning on virtualizing instances of a server, especially a Windows Server, VmWare GSX or ESX server would be the only real options. Regarding licensing issues, a virtual machine is exactly that, a virtual representation of a completely different machine. It will show up the the OS as different hardware. Have any of you tried activating an XP installation within VPC or VmWare? It still asks for a new, unique key (unless of course, its a volume license). People question the financial costs of this, that Microsoft will now forgo the revenue on four vista licenses. First of all, many estimate that Vista will retail at as low as $100. There will actually be tighter license restrictions, as there are plans to have an active licensing server for volume licenses, instead of the honor system currently in place (which is often abused). The motivation of this deal isn't to make money, its to promote certain technologies, and to encourage people to convert and stay with the Windows platform. Why does Microsoft give away millions of dollars of software in the form of the MSDN Academic Alliance every year to schools and students? Why does it have an entire "software evangelist" program? It's not to make money in the immediate short term, but to make people convert to Microsoft products, many of which are quite well made. (Anyone play with Visual Studio Team Foundation Server?) Sure, there are open source alternatives but sometimes its easier to click a few buttons on a GUI instead of customizing a .conf file. And, if people convert to the Microsoft way of doing things, they're more likely to purchase the money makers, like Office, or use certain software solutions when making purchasing decisions for their IT department.